How to trigger rs.slaveOk() from Splunk MongoDB (Hunk) app to query data from secondary instance

We have a requirement of querying MongoDB collections from secondary instance using Splunk MongoDB app (Hunk). The virtual indexes are working perfectly fine when we configure the primary MongoDB instance in indexes.conf. However as per recommendation from DB team, we need to point our splunk to query the secondary MongoDB instance. But when we configure the secondary instance IP in indexes.conf, the virtual indexes are failing to pull data from DB. On further investigation, we found the reason is, we need to set "rs.slaveOk()" in secondary instance each time before querying the data. We don't see any option at configuration level to trigger "rs.slaveOk()" through MongoDB app.

Is there any way to achieve that? Any sort of help will be highly appreciated.
